Installation Note:
Professional installation strongly recommended for optimal safety and performance
Install as complete set for balanced braking performance across both axles
Replace all brake pads simultaneously with disc installation
Thoroughly clean all hub surfaces before installation to ensure proper mounting
Follow proper bed-in procedures: avoid aggressive braking for initial 200-300 km
Check brake fluid level and system integrity after installation
Conduct comprehensive road test to verify balanced braking performance
Use appropriate safety equipment and follow workshop procedures during installation
